The third episode of season three of The Charge, San José State’s All-Access Show, will be airing on Tuesday, April 30 at 6 and 8 p.m. on NBC Sports Bay Area. This episode will feature a range of exciting events that have been happening at SJSU recently.
In the first segment, viewers will be introduced to the ‘Bash Brothers’, Hunter Dorraugh and Dalton Bowling, who are rewriting the home run record book at SJSU. These two players are truly making history with their impressive performances on the baseball field.
The second segment will highlight the women’s gymnastics team’s return to the NCAA Regional at Cal. This is an exciting opportunity for these talented athletes to showcase their skills and compete against some of the best teams in the country.
Emilia Sjostrand’s runner-up finish at the NCAA Indoor Championships will also be featured in this episode, as it led SJSU to its first top-25 finish at nationals. This is a major milestone for SJSU and its athletic program, and it’s sure to be celebrated by fans and athletes alike.
Finally, the fourth segment will showcase SJSU becoming the first Mountain West school to earn three consecutive SAAC Community Service Awards. This is a huge achievement for Spartans and demonstrates their commitment to giving back to their community through service and volunteering efforts.
